Securing NCLEX Certification: Understanding the Process and Requirements
Aspiring registered nurses must successfully conquer the National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X) to obtain their license and begin practicing. This comprehensive exam evaluates a candidate's knowledge and competence in providing safe, effective patient care.
The NCLEX comprises two primary parts: the computerized adaptive testing (CAT) format and the traditional multiple-choice questions. During the CAT portion, the difficulty of the questions varies based on the candidate's performance. Candidates must demonstrate their understanding of various nursing concepts, including pharmacology, medical-surgical nursing, pediatrics, and mental health.
To be eligible for the NCLEX, candidates must finish an accredited nursing program and have met all state licensing criteria. After graduating, aspiring nurses must apply to their state's Board of Nursing and submit the necessary documentation.
